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Fox River Park (Ottawa, IL)
Fox River Park is situated on the west side of Ottawa, Illinois, easily accessible via major roadways. The primary access point is from Ontario Street, which connects to Illinois Route 23, a key north-south artery for the city. For those arriving by air, the closest major airport is Chicago Rockford International Airport (RFD), located approximately 55 miles northwest, with a drive typically ranging from 1 hour to 1 hour and 15 minutes depending on traffic. Alternatively, Chicago Midway International Airport (MDW) and Chicago O'Hare International Airport (ORD) are further afield, requiring a longer drive of 1.5 to 2.5 hours. Within Ottawa, I-80 is a short drive north, providing eastbound and westbound access to the wider region. Public transportation within Ottawa is limited, making a personal vehicle or rideshare service the most convenient options for reaching the park and exploring the surrounding areas. Plan your arrival to allow for potential local traffic, especially during peak event weekends or community festival times.

Weather & Seasons at Fox River Park
- Winter: Winter in Ottawa, Illinois, can be cold and brisk, with average temperatures often hovering in the 20s and 30s Fahrenheit. Visitors should pack heavy coats, hats, gloves, and insulated footwear. Outdoor activities are limited, and early evening darkness means events typically conclude before dusk.
- Spring & early summer: Spring and early summer bring milder temperatures, ranging from the 50s to the 70s Fahrenheit, with increasing daylight. Light jackets or sweatshirts are often needed for mornings and evenings, while short sleeves are comfortable during the day. This is a prime season for sports, but be prepared for occasional rain showers that can affect field conditions.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er, from July into August, typically sees warm to hot temperatures, frequently reaching the 80s and 90s Fahrenheit, with high humidity. Lightweight, breathable clothing is essential. Staying hydrated is critical, and planning activities for cooler parts of the day is advisable. Sunscreen and hats are highly recommended.
- Fall season: Fall offers a pleasant transition with temperatures gradually cooling from the 60s to the 40s Fahrenheit. Days are often sunny and comfortable, making it ideal for sports. Layers are key, as mornings can be chilly and afternoons mild. Long sleeves, light jackets, and comfortable trousers are suitable for this season.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ible in all seasons, but more frequent in spring and fall. Come prepared with rain gear, especially during these months. Snowfall typically occurs in winter, which can lead to event cancellations or adjustments. Check local weather forecasts regularly when planning your visit, as conditions can change rapidly.
